Roof damage restoration services involve assessing and repairing issues caused by various types of damage to a property's roof. This process typically includes inspecting the roof for signs of wear, leaks, or structural problems, then performing necessary repairs to restore its integrity. Service providers may replace damaged shingles, fix leaks, reinforce weakened areas, and ensure the roof is properly sealed to prevent future issues. The goal is to restore the roof’s protective function and extend its lifespan, helping homeowners maintain a safe and secure residence.
These services are especially valuable when dealing with problems such as storm damage, fallen tree branches, hail impacts, or aging materials that have deteriorated over time. Common signs that indicate a roof may need restoration include missing or cracked shingles, water stains on ceilings or walls, and visible sagging or warping.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ive damage, such as mold growth, mold, or structural deterioration, which can lead to costly repairs if left untreated.

The overview below groups typical Roof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Missouri City,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- minor roof damage repairs, such as replacing a few shingles or fixing small leaks, typ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.
Moderate Repairs - more extensive repairs like patching larger sections or addressing multiple leaks can range from $600 to $2,000. These projects are common when addressing ongoing issues or storm-related damage.
Full Roof Replacement - replacing an entire roof in Missouri City, TX, often costs between $5,000 and $12,000, depending on roof size, materials, and complexity. Larger or more complex projects can exceed this range, especially for premium materials.
Complex or Large-Scale Projects - major damage from severe storms or extensive wear can push costs above $12,000, with some projects reaching $20,000+ for complete overhauls on larger properties. These are less common but represent the upper end of typical project cost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
